Ken Curtis (born July 2, 1916 – died April 28, 1991; aged 74) was the actor who played Festus Haggen in seasons 8-20 of Gunsmoke. Although he appeared on Gunsmoke earlier in other roles, he was first cast as Festus in season 8 episode 13, December 8, 1962 "Us Haggens" (episode #13). His next appearance was in the Season 9 episode (#2) on October 5, 1963 as Kyle Kelly, in "Lover Boy". Gunsmoke is an American radio and television Western drama series created by director Norman MacDonnell and writer John Meston. The stories take place in and around Dodge City, Kansas, during the settlement of the American West. The central character is lawman Marshal Matt Dillon, played by William Conrad on radio and James Arness on television. "Once a Haggen" was the 18th episode of Season 9 of Gunsmoke, also the 323nd overall episode of the series. Directed by Andrew V. McLaglen, the episode, which was written by Les Crutchfield, was originally broadcast on CBS-TV on February 1, 1964. A friend of Festus' is accused of murdering the man who bested them at poker.
